Step 1: Assess the Damage
Before continuing with the replacement, examine the [Pella Window Handle Replacement](https://brokenwindowhandle32444.widblog.com/94802310/9-signs-that-you-re-a-andersen-window-handle-replacement-expert) handle to identify the extent of the damage. Is it totally broken off, or is it simply stuck? Knowing this can assist in choosing the suitable course of action.
Action 2: Gather Tools and Supplies
Ensure you have all the required tools and the replacement handle on hand. This will help the process go smoothly without unneeded interruptions.
Step 3: Remove the Old HandleFind the Screws: Examine the base of the handle to find the screws holding it in location.Unscrew the Handle: Using the proper screwdriver, thoroughly unscrew the handle. If the screws are rusty or tough to remove, use some lube to loosen them.Get rid of the Handle: Once the screws are gotten rid of, gently manage the handle. If it's stuck, use pliers carefully to wiggle it loose.Step 4: Prepare the New HandleMatch the New Handle: Compare the brand-new handle with the old one to guarantee they match in size and mechanism.Line Up the New Handle: Position the new handle on the window where the old handle was eliminated, guaranteeing screw holes align.Step 5: Install the New HandleSecure the Handle: Insert the screws into the aligned holes and tighten them thoroughly. Guarantee the handle is safe and secure however do not overtighten, as it may trigger damage.Test the Handle: Once set up, evaluate the handle by opening and closing the window numerous times to ensure it works properly.Action 6: Clean Up
After replacing the handle, gather all tools and products, and deal with the old handle properly.

A1: Yes, with the right tools and fundamental DIY abilities, most homeowners can change window manages themselves.
Q2: What if I can't discover a specific replacement for my handle?
A2: If an exact match is not available, think about calling the window manufacturer for a compatible replacement or consult a regional hardware store for alternatives.
Q3: Can I utilize any type of handle for my window?
A3: No, it's important to use a handle specifically created for your type of window for appropriate function and safety.
Q4: What tools do I require for the replacement?
A4: You will need screwdrivers, pliers, a replacement handle, determining tape, safety glasses, gloves, and lubricant.
Q5: How often should I inspect my window handles for wear and tear?
A5: It's a good practice to check window manages at least twice a year for any signs of wear, especially before and after severe weather changes.
